Cuddfan Monterey Hide
Cuddfan Monterey Hide is a wildlife hide in Llangennith, Llanmadoc and Cheriton, Swansea, Wales. Cuddfan Monterey Hide is situated nearby to Cwm Ivy Marsh, as well as near the ruins Lime Kiln.Places of Interest Nearby

Llangennith
Village
Photo: Rodw, Public domain.
Llangennith is a village in the City and County of Swansea, South Wales. It is located in the Gower. Moor Lane leads westwards to a caravan park near Rhossili Bay and Burrows Lane leads northwards to a caravan park overlooking Broughton Bay. Gower Peninsula
Photo: Catrin Austin, CC BY 2.0.
The beautiful Gower Peninsula in Swansea was the United Kingdom's first designated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ty. The peninsula is famous for its stunning coastal scenery, wide sandy beaches and medieval castles.
